*How to get a Yahoo! ID!*

 

Many of us seem to be having problems with (a) getting a yahoo ID and (b) linking it to your address

 

*What does that mean?*

 

OK, picture that an RPG is a members only club. You can't get in without flashing your ID; before you can flash your ID you need to get an ID. So you apply for one, but your ID is useless without a photo or description of you that associates you with your ID.

 

With Yahoo! Your ID is a name or word; unfortunately there are so many people around the world with yahoo! IDs that most of the good words and almost all of the names are taken. So you have to choose something original that no one else has. Your name and sir name is a good idea, but I'll leave that to you.

Once you have an ID you still need to link your ID with you, the way to do this is to link your ID with your e-mail Address, after all, to yahoo you are an e-mail address*

 

*Your e-mail address is what is a member of the RPG, you only get your group mail because you are the owner of your e-mail address. For all yahoo knows James T. Kirk could be receiving the mail posted to [email protected].

 

*How do I do this?*

 

*Get yourself an ID:*

estimated time: +- 6 minutes

 

a) Go into yahoo (www.yahoo.com)

 

b) A web page will appear with Yahoo! at the top. Find a link that tells you that you can sign up for a yahoo ID. Click on it.

 

c) Fill out the form.

 

d) There will be a link or button* at the end that says something along the lines of submit or apply for this account. Click it.

 

e) If the application does not go, there will be red writing near the top of the screen telling you what mistakes you made. If there is no red writing congratulations, you have a yahoo ID.

 

f) Log off the Internet or carry on with something different on the net

 

 

*Link it to your address:*

estimated time: +- 3 minutes

 

You will have received a message from yahoo telling you that your registration is confirmed, this means you have an ID, the one you chose earlier

 

a) go to yahoo again.

 

b) This time when the Yahoo page comes up go to the gray box on the right hand side of the screen (if not click on sign in) and fill in as follows:

 

(The gray is on the screen; the black is what you type in)

 

Yahoo

ID: (type in your new yahoo ID)

Alternative address:

(Type in your e-mail address)

Password:  

 (In filling in your form you chose a password, type that in (remember capital letters count)

 

c) The page that appears will be a welcome to yahoo. Find the link that says  Conversion Wizard. Click on it.

 

d) Follow the instructions.

 

e) When they ask for an authorization code click on the link that says that you don't have one, within one minute you will receive an e-mail from yahoo telling you your code.

 

f) Carry on following instructions. The rest is easy.
